你查询的IP:[159.226.235.60]  地理位置:中国–北京–北京科技网

最新查询121.199.16.55 59.151.168.95 60.252.96.250 123.138.91.56 58.32.134.115 116.4.144.170 116.199.136.22 203.196.209.24 119.40.219.92 159.226.235.60 125.215.133.37 122.204.107.87 116.76.192.129 118.228.137.13 121.58.130.23 121.48.138.212 119.8.86.142 118.126.176.65 202.179.240.147 202.91.224.150 202.41.240.90 168.160.51.223 202.150.16.161 119.58.17.189 60.194.146.251 192.83.122.159 121.4.23.182 202.153.48.162 125.58.128.252 221.199.128.26 118.88.32.169